It selects the top 250 based on a certain criteria, then it randomly picks a few everyday to show.

It deliberately doesn't always pick the top groups, because there is a large dropoff between the top 25 or so and the rest of them. The point is to expose you to more than just the biggest and most well known groups. It is to expose you to groups that are a little smaller, but still do good stuff.

So, I think it works exactly how it should be working.
